directions

  • Preheat oven to 425 degrees F (220 degrees C).
  • Melt the butter in a saucepan.
  • Stir in flour to form a paste.
  • Add water, white sugar and brown sugar, and bring to a boil.
  • Reduce temperature and let simmer.
  • Place the bottom crust in your pan.
  • Fill with apples, mounded slightly.
  • Cover with a lattice work of crust.
  • Gently pour the sugar and butter liquid over the crust. Pour slowly so that it does not run off.
  • Bake 15 minutes in the preheated oven. Reduce the temperature to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C).
  • Continue baking for 35 to 45 minutes, until apples are soft.
